Overview

Query the ClinicalTrials.gov API v2 (public, no authentication) to search and retrieve clinical trial data worldwide. Supports searching by condition, intervention, location, sponsor, and status; retrieving detailed study information by NCT ID; paginating large result sets; and exporting to CSV.

Prerequisites

uv pip install requests pandas

API details:

  • Base URL: https://clinicaltrials.gov/api/v2
  • Authentication: None required (public API)
  • Rate limit: ~50 requests/minute per IP
  • Response formats: JSON (default), CSV
  • Max page size: 1000 studies per request
  • Date format: ISO 8601; text fields use CommonMark Markdown

Key Concepts

Response Data Structure

ClinicalTrials.gov returns deeply nested JSON. Key navigation paths:

| Data | Path |

|------|------|

| NCT ID | study['protocolSection']['identificationModule']['nctId'] |

| Title | study['protocolSection']['identificationModule']['briefTitle'] |

| Status | study['protocolSection']['statusModule']['overallStatus'] |

| Phase | study['protocolSection']['designModule']['phases'] |

| Enrollment | study['protocolSection']['designModule']['enrollmentInfo']['count'] |

| Eligibility | study['protocolSection']['eligibilityModule'] |

| Locations | study['protocolSection']['contactsLocationsModule']['locations'] |

| Interventions | study['protocolSection']['armsInterventionsModule']['interventions'] |

| Results | study.get('resultsSection') (None if no results posted) |

Study Status Values

| Status | Description |

|--------|-------------|

| RECRUITING | Currently recruiting participants |

| NOT_YET_RECRUITING | Approved but not yet open |

| ENROLLING_BY_INVITATION | Invitation-only enrollment |

| ACTIVE_NOT_RECRUITING | Active, enrollment closed |

| SUSPENDED | Temporarily halted |

| TERMINATED | Stopped prematurely |

| COMPLETED | Study concluded |

| WITHDRAWN | Withdrawn before enrollment |

Study Phase Values

| Phase | Description |

|-------|-------------|

| EARLY_PHASE1 | Early Phase 1 (formerly Phase 0) |

| PHASE1 | Phase 1 — safety and dosing |

| PHASE2 | Phase 2 — efficacy and side effects |

| PHASE3 | Phase 3 — large-scale efficacy |

| PHASE4 | Phase 4 — post-market surveillance |

| NA | Not applicable (non-drug studies) |

Query Parameters Reference

| Parameter | Type | Description | Example |

|-----------|------|-------------|---------|

| query.cond | string | Condition/disease | lung cancer |

| query.intr | string | Intervention/drug | Pembrolizumab |

| query.locn | string | Geographic location | New York |

| query.spons | string | Sponsor name | National Cancer Institute |

| query.term | string | General full-text search | immunotherapy |

| filter.overallStatus | string | Status filter (comma-separated) | RECRUITING,COMPLETED |

| filter.phase | string | Phase filter | PHASE2,PHASE3 |

| filter.ids | string | NCT ID filter | NCT04852770 |

| sort | string | Sort order | LastUpdatePostDate:desc |

| pageSize | int | Results per page (max 1000) | 100 |

| pageToken | string | Pagination token | (from previous response) |

| format | string | Response format | json or csv |

Sort options: LastUpdatePostDate, EnrollmentCount, StartDate, StudyFirstPostDate — each with :asc or :desc.

Core API

1. Search by Condition

results = ct_search({
    "query.cond": "type 2 diabetes",
    "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ING",
    "pageSize": 20,
    "sort": "LastUpdatePostDate:desc"
})
print(f"Found {results['totalCount']} recruiting diabetes trials")
for study in results['studies'][:5]:
    proto = study['protocolSection']
    nct = proto['identificationModule']['nctId']
    title = proto['identificationModule']['briefTitle']
    print(f"  {nct}: {title}")

2. Search by Intervention/Drug

# Find Phase 3 trials testing Pembrolizumab
results = ct_search({
    "query.intr": "Pembrolizumab",
    "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ING,ACTIVE_NOT_RECRUITING",
    "filter.phase": "PHASE3",
    "pageSize": 50
})
print(f"Phase 3 Pembrolizumab trials: {results['totalCount']}")

3. Search by Location

results = ct_search({
    "query.cond": "cancer",
    "query.locn": "New York",
    "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ING",
    "pageSize": 20
})

# Extract location details
for study in results['studies'][:3]:
    locs = study['protocolSection'].get('contactsLocationsModule', {}).get('locations', [])
    for loc in locs:
        if 'New York' in loc.get('city', ''):
            print(f"  {loc.get('facility')}: {loc['city']}, {loc.get('state', '')}")

4. Search by Sponsor

results = ct_search({
    "query.spons": "National Cancer Institute",
    "pageSize": 20
})

for study in results['studies'][:5]:
    sponsor_mod = study['protocolSection']['sponsorCollaboratorsModule']
    lead = sponsor_mod['leadSponsor']['name']
    collabs = [c['name'] for c in sponsor_mod.get('collaborators', [])]
    print(f"  Lead: {lead}, Collaborators: {collabs}")

5. Retrieve Study Details by NCT ID

nct_id = "NCT04852770"
response = requests.get(f"{CT_API}/studies/{nct_id}", timeout=30)
response.raise_for_status()
study = response.json()

# Extract key information
proto = study['protocolSection']
print(f"Title: {proto['identificationModule']['briefTitle']}")
print(f"Status: {proto['statusModule']['overallStatus']}")

# Eligibility criteria
elig = proto.get('eligibilityModule', {})
print(f"Ages: {elig.get('minimumAge')} - {elig.get('maximumAge')}")
print(f"Sex: {elig.get('sex')}")
print(f"Criteria:\n{elig.get('eligibilityCriteria', 'N/A')[:300]}")

6. Pagination for Large Result Sets

all_studies = []
page_token = None
max_pages = 10

for page in range(max_pages):
    params = {
        "query.cond": "cancer",
        "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ING",
        "pageSize": 1000,
    }
    if page_token:
        params["pageToken"] = page_token

    results = ct_search(params)
    all_studies.extend(results['studies'])
    page_token = results.get('nextPageToken')

    if not page_token:
        break
    time.sleep(1.5)  # respect rate limits

print(f"Retrieved {len(all_studies)} studies across {page + 1} pages")

7. Export to CSV

response = requests.get(f"{CT_API}/studies", params={
    "query.cond": "heart disease",
    "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ING",
    "format": "csv",
    "pageSize": 1000
}, timeout=60)

with open("heart_disease_trials.csv", "w") as f:
    f.write(response.text)
print("Exported to heart_disease_trials.csv")

Common Workflows

Workflow 1: Multi-Criteria Trial Discovery

import requests, time

CT_API = "https://clinicaltrials.gov/api/v2"

def ct_search(params):
    response = requests.get(f"{CT_API}/studies", params=params, timeout=30)
    response.raise_for_status()
    return response.json()

# Step 1: Search with multiple filters
results = ct_search({
    "query.cond": "lung cancer",
    "query.intr": "immunotherapy",
    "query.locn": "California",
    "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ING,NOT_YET_RECRUITING",
    "pageSize": 100,
    "sort": "LastUpdatePostDate:desc"
})
print(f"Total matches: {results['totalCount']}")

# Step 2: Filter by phase
phase23 = [
    s for s in results['studies']
    if any(p in ['PHASE2', 'PHASE3']
           for p in s['protocolSection'].get('designModule', {}).get('phases', []))
]
print(f"Phase 2/3 trials: {len(phase23)}")

# Step 3: Extract summaries
for study in phase23[:5]:
    proto = study['protocolSection']
    nct = proto['identificationModule']['nctId']
    title = proto['identificationModule']['briefTitle']
    enrollment = proto.get('designModule', {}).get('enrollmentInfo', {}).get('count', 'N/A')
    print(f"  {nct}: {title} (n={enrollment})")

Workflow 2: Completed Trials with Results Analysis

# Step 1: Find completed trials with posted results
results = ct_search({
    "query.cond": "alzheimer disease",
    "filter.overallStatus": "COMPLETED",
    "pageSize": 100,
    "sort": "LastUpdatePostDate:desc"
})

with_results = [s for s in results['studies'] if s.get('hasResults', False)]
print(f"Completed with results: {len(with_results)} / {len(results['studies'])}")

# Step 2: Get detailed results for top trial
if with_results:
    nct = with_results[0]['protocolSection']['identificationModule']['nctId']
    detail = requests.get(f"{CT_API}/studies/{nct}", timeout=30).json()

    if 'resultsSection' in detail:
        outcomes = detail['resultsSection'].get('outcomeMeasuresModule', {})
        measures = outcomes.get('outcomeMeasures', [])
        for m in measures[:3]:
            print(f"  Outcome: {m.get('title')}")
            print(f"  Type: {m.get('type')}")

Workflow 3: Sponsor Portfolio Comparison

sponsors = ["Pfizer", "Novartis", "Roche"]
for sponsor in sponsors:
    results = ct_search({
        "query.spons": sponsor,
        "filter.overallStatus": "RECRUITING",
        "pageSize": 1
    })
    print(f"{sponsor}: {results['totalCount']} recruiting trials")
    time.sleep(1.5)

Recipe: Extract Study Summary

def extract_summary(study):
    proto = study.get('protocolSection', {})
    ident = proto.get('identificationModule', {})
    status = proto.get('statusModule', {})
    design = proto.get('designModule', {})
    return {
        'nct_id': ident.get('nctId'),
        'title': ident.get('officialTitle') or ident.get('briefTitle'),
        'status': status.get('overallStatus'),
        'phases': design.get('phases', []),
        'enrollment': design.get('enrollmentInfo', {}).get('count'),
        'last_update': status.get('lastUpdatePostDateStruct', {}).get('date')
    }

# Usage
for study in results['studies'][:3]:
    s = extract_summary(study)
    print(f"{s['nct_id']}: {s['status']} | Phase: {s['phases']} | n={s['enrollment']}")

Recipe: Safe Field Navigation

def safe_get(study, *keys, default='N/A'):
    """Navigate nested study JSON safely."""
    current = study
    for key in keys:
        if isinstance(current, dict):
            current = current.get(key)
        else:
            return default
        if current is None:
            return default
    return current

# Usage — handles missing fields gracefully
nct = safe_get(study, 'protocolSection', 'identificationModule', 'nctId')
phases = safe_get(study, 'protocolSection', 'designModule', 'phases', default=[])
enrollment = safe_get(study, 'protocolSection', 'designModule', 'enrollmentInfo', 'count')

Troubleshooting

| Problem | Cause | Solution |

|---------|-------|----------|

| 429 Too Many Requests | Rate limit exceeded (~50/min) | Wait 60s; use max pageSize=1000; implement exponential backoff |

| Empty studies array | No trials match filters | Broaden search (remove status/phase filters); check spelling |

| 400 Bad Request | Invalid parameter value | Verify status/phase values match enumeration exactly (e.g., RECRUITING not recruiting) |

| Missing resultsSection | Trial has no posted results | Check study['hasResults'] before accessing results |

| KeyError on nested field | Not all trials have all modules | Use .get() with defaults or safe_get helper (see Recipes) |

| Pagination stops early | nextPageToken absent | All results retrieved; check totalCount vs collected count |

| CSV format differs from JSON | Different field structure | CSV flattens nested structure; use JSON for programmatic access |

| Timeout on large exports | CSV with many results | Increase timeout; paginate with pageSize=1000 instead |

Best Practices

  • Use maximum page size (1000) for bulk retrieval to minimize request count against rate limit
  • Always check hasResults before accessing resultsSection — most trials have no posted results
  • Navigate safely with .get() chains — not all trials populate all modules (especially contactsLocationsModule, armsInterventionsModule)
  • Specify multiple status values with commas (e.g., RECRUITING,NOT_YET_RECRUITING) — don't make separate requests per status
  • Use sort=LastUpdatePostDate:desc by default — returns most recently updated trials first
  • Date interpretation: lastUpdatePostDateStruct.date is ISO 8601 string; type field indicates ACTUAL vs ESTIMATED
